Solution:
Given,
Mass of an object (m) = 3 kg,
height = distance covered by stone (h) = 3 m,
Acceleration due to gravity (g) = 10 m/s2
Work done against the gravity = force (F) × displacement (h) = F × h
We also know that Force (F) = Mass of an object (m) × acceleration due to the gravity (g) = m×g
Hence, the work done against gravity becomes
W = m×g×h
= 3 kg × 10 m/s2 × 3m
= 90 joule
Hence, the work done against gravity is 90 Joule.
